70 Best Bible Verses About God’s Timing and Plans

One of the greatest tests of faith in the Christian life is learning to trust in God’s timing and plans. We often want immediate answers, quick outcomes, and a clear path forward, but God rarely works on our timeline. Instead, He calls us to wait, to walk by faith and not by sight, and to trust that His plans are higher than ours. Trusting God’s timing is more than patience—it’s a spiritual posture of surrender, rest, and confidence in His sovereignty.

The Bible is filled with stories of people who had to wait on the Lord—Abraham waited for a son, Joseph waited in prison, Moses waited in the desert, and David waited to become king. In each case, God’s timing shaped their character and prepared them for their purpose. When you trust in God’s plans, even in delay, you’re saying, “Lord, I believe You know what’s best.” Whether you’re waiting on a job, healing, breakthrough, or answers, God’s delay is never a denial—it’s a sign of divine wisdom and perfect timing.

God’s Timing Prepares You for the Blessing He Has Ordained

Often, we think waiting is wasted time—but in God’s eyes, it is preparation. What feels like a delay may be God building your faith, maturing your character, or clearing the way for something greater. When we try to rush God’s process, we risk stepping out of His will. But when we trust His timing, we walk in alignment with His best.

The purpose of God’s delay is not to frustrate you but to form you. He may be protecting you from something you’re not ready for or preparing you for a blessing that requires greater spiritual maturity. Trusting His plan means believing that every step, every pause, and every redirection is filled with intentionality. God never forgets His promises, and He always brings them to pass in the fullness of time.

God’s Plans Are Perfect Even When the Path Is Unclear

It’s natural to want answers, direction, and a quick resolution. But faith means moving forward even when we don’t understand the why or the when. Trusting God’s plan is a decision to believe that His heart for you is good and His outcome will be better than anything you could design. You may not know the timeline, but you can be confident in the One who holds the timeline.

In moments of uncertainty, God invites you to walk with Him step by step. He may not reveal the whole path, but He will always provide enough light for the next step. His plans are never random—they are perfectly timed, carefully crafted, and deeply loving. God’s Perfect Timing

He has made everything beautiful in its time. He has also set eternity in the human heart; yet no one can fathom what God has done from beginning to end.

Ecclesiastes 3:11 – “He has made everything beautiful in its time…”

This verse assures us that God’s timing is flawless, even when we cannot fully understand His eternal plan.

Waiting on the Lord

But they that wait upon the Lord shall renew their strength; they shall mount up with wings as eagles; they shall run, and not be weary; and they shall walk, and not faint.

Isaiah 40:31 – “But they that wait upon the Lord shall renew their strength…”

Patience in waiting on God leads to strength, endurance, and spiritual renewal.

God’s Plans to Prosper You

For I know the plans I have for you,” declares the Lord, “plans to prosper you and not to harm you, plans to give you hope and a future.

Jeremiah 29:11 – “For I know the plans I have for you…”

God’s plans are always for our good, offering us hope and assurance in every season.

The Steps of the Righteous

The steps of a good man are ordered by the Lord: and he delighteth in his way.

Psalm 37:23 – “The steps of a good man are ordered by the Lord…”

Every step you take is guided by God when you walk faithfully with Him.

Summary

God’s timing and plans remind us that He is sovereign, wise, and faithful. Throughout Scripture, we see the Lord’s assurance that His purposes will stand, even when we cannot fully understand His ways. These verses call us to wait patiently, to trust deeply, and to rest in the truth that God makes everything beautiful in His time. His timing is not delayed but perfect, working for our ultimate good and His glory.

The verses on God’s timing also strengthen our faith during seasons of waiting. When life feels uncertain, they reassure us that the Lord has already gone ahead, preparing the way. He plans to prosper and not to harm, to give hope and a future. While we may long for immediate answers, Scripture encourages us to remain steadfast, knowing God’s appointed time brings fulfillment and peace.

As we meditate on these passages, our hearts are reminded that God’s timing is always worth the wait. He aligns our steps with His divine plan, shapes our character in seasons of waiting, and brings forth blessings in due season. By trusting His promises and surrendering our will, we walk in confidence that the One who began a good work will carry it to completion according to His perfect plan.
